Open Streets Macon returns Sunday, September 12th from 2 pm to 6 pm with a new route! The streets of Macon will leap to life as Boulevard (from the Ocmulgee Heritage Trail to Clinton Rd.) becomes a paved park. The street will be closed to motorized traffic (except for intersections where cars will be free to cross). There is no registration, and Open Streets Macon is FREE and open to the public.

Organized by Bike Walk Macon, Open Streets Macon is a car-free celebration of public space; bringing people of all ages, abilities, and backgrounds together to walk, skate, bike, play, and re-imagine how we use our public streets.
